There is an upgraded part. If you feel inside the rounded upper back part of the plastic piece, it is hollow. The new part they put on has a lining in it of what feels like a semi hard rubber to reinforce it. It can be seen barely sticking past the inside edge toward the seat. I will try to get some pics tomorrow but it will be difficult to capture. They apparently will automatically send this part when they order the replacement since my dealership service department had not heard about an upgraded part. I showed them the difference. Yes it was covered under warranty, no cost to me. Now, better than new.

Had the same thing happen to Driver's seat. Issue is, cheap plastic piece that holds molding snug to seat. Mine unfortunately broke after my warranty ran out and I'm sure their repair would eventually break as well. Can't understand why on the passenger seat, this piece is metal?? Headed to Lowe's for some hardware and JB Weld and repaired on my own. So far is holding up very well.

I didn't think to take pics as I did it, wasn't sure it would work. But this is all you need. The corner brace will replace the plastic piece that broke off. Align corner brace on post on molding. Drill hole through hole on corner brace that will be attached to post. Apply jb weld and secure on post. Use screw and bolt for added support. Wait for jb weld to dry. Put back on the seat.
